Output 51ecd2973d1e254e9dbac9dd9399b7cb2aa876a3f38cf6af131c98898e6ce90e:1

value
2769295452
script pubkey
OP_0 OP_PUSHBYTES_20 d18209af50d5eb4b46d000a62e3012aed61fda0e
address
tb1q6xpqnt6s6h45k3ksqznzuvqj4mtplkswu6gavd
transaction
51ecd2973d1e254e9dbac9dd9399b7cb2aa876a3f38cf6af131c98898e6ce90e